This is a photo portrait of Rafe the ginger tom cat who spends a great deal of time hanging around in our garden. We have no idea who he belongs to, but he bumbles along with our 15 (neutered) cats with only the occasional disagreement. He is a lovely cat and obviously domesticated but has decided our cat garden is not a bad place to hang out. As you can see, he looks very comfortable and as if he belongs in place, as he looks directly at the viewer with his paws neatly folded under him.
